Data warehouse services

Data Warehouse Services

ai_2

Data Never Sleeps. Make Sure You Turn It Into Value.

Every day, businesses struggle with fragmented, slow data systems that hinder decision-making. Sales teams wait for critical business insights as they’re dependent on IT teams to run queries and set up dashboards. Finance teams grapple with discrepancies in multiple spreadsheets and inaccuracies in reports, while IT teams are  overwhelmed fixing software bugs. Leadership is forced to make decisions based on outdated, unreliable data.

We specialize in setting up Cloud-native Data Warehouses using scalable platforms like Snowflake and Amazon Redshift, that eliminate barriers with traditional solutions, and accelerate business operations. Whether you’re starting from scratch or modernizing outdated systems, we build new data warehouses or migrate and optimize your existing data infrastructure. Our solutions ensure fast, real-time queries, seamless data integration, and improved performance.

To keep your systems refreshed and in sync, we automate data movement with Kafka-based pipelines, enabling real-time data flow across all systems. 

Security is not an afterthought, but is something carefully designed into our Data solutions. We integrate IBM Guardium to automatically classify, encrypt, and secure your sensitive data while implementing role-based access, so only the right teams have access to the information they need.

AI ML
Instant 360

View Of Customers

10x

Faster Business Decisions

80%

Reduction in Cloud Costs

Download The Master Guide For Building Delightful, Sticky Apps In 2025.

Build your app like a PRO. Nail everything from that first lightbulb moment to the first million.

When data is stored in disparate, disconnected systems, it becomes hard to get a clear, holistic view of your business. It should be simple to make sense of what’s happening, make timely decisions and be operationally efficient, isn’t it?

Centralize all of your Data and set up AI Agents to act like your Analyst, with Codewave’s Data Warehouse Services and Agentic AI Development Services. We make it easier to analyze, and act on your data with the power of Gen AI and Agentic AI.

If you’re struggling with issues like data discrepancies, slow report generation, disparate systems and inefficient processes; our Data Warehouse Advisory Service is for you.

We start by assessing your current Data systems, processes and infrastructure to identify issues and what needs fixing. We also understand your business vision and Data strategy, how you aspire to use Data as your competitive advantage. Based on our findings and strategic alignment, we recommend solutions. We also provide expert consulting and implementation of security best practices, compliances, governance and ethics, strengthening your Data management capabilities.

Example: A business wants to make Data as its strategic MOAT, to differentiate itself from competitors. But their current systems and infra, aren’t fast and accurate enough. We migrate them into modern day platforms where Data flows seamlessly in realtime and is made actionable for AI Agents to automate actions, giving the business a strategic advantage and making it difficult for competitors to replicate their USP.

When your data is scattered across disparate systems like Salesforce and SAP, it is difficult to unify, centralize Data, make sense of it and get a clear, holistic view of your business reality when it matters. It’s tough to make strategic decisions when you’re constantly fighting with fragmented data that’s not realtime or inaccessible in realtime.

We design and implement cloud-native data warehouses that centralize and simplify your data. Using Snowflake, we analyze your data sources and create an architecture that ensures seamless integration, flow and cloud-native scalability. We implement Apache Kafka for real-time data flow and Fivetran for automating ETL pipelines, reducing manual work and improving data accuracy.

For example, a retail business brings all its Data from demand to supply in one system (marketing, sales, customers, orders, warehouse, inventory, production), making the business operate like a well-orchestrated symphony. When demand changes, the supply and pricing is dynamically adjusted. Sales teams stay on top of changing prices and sales / orders, adjust their promotions to stimulate demand.

You know the signs—queries take forever, reports don’t show correct numbers, and even small updates break things. Outdated data systems don’t make your business fast.

We help businesses embrace modern day Data platforms for speed, agility and accuracy. We help migrate from legacy, on-premise data warehouses to cloud-native platforms like Snowflake or Redshift—without downtime or data loss. Starting with an assessment, we choose the right platform, architecture and a migration strategy. We use AWS DMS for seamless, zero-downtime database migration, Azure Data Factory to rebuild scalable ETL pipelines, and dbt to carry over business logic intact, ensuring data consistency post-migration.

For example, a telecom provider migrating from an on-prem Oracle DWH to Redshift sees their month-end reporting take just 20 minutes, instead of 6 hours. In this case, data models, access rules, and ETL jobs are replicated without rewriting from scratch—your teams keep working without disruption.

Even the best data warehouse doesn’t entirely run on autopilot. With rapid changes in the Digital world, your warehouse can fail to tick off new compliances, continue to use obsolete practices, pipelines may fail and your teams quietly stop trusting what they see. When issues are discovered too late—after they’ve already impacted decisions, your business loses time and opportunity.

We provide ongoing support to keep your data warehouse healthy, accurate, and audit-ready. Our team uses Azure Monitor and AWS CloudWatch to monitor pipeline health and job failures, while dbt helps with automated testing to catch broken stuff before they affect your dashboards. We fix schema drift, patch integration issues, and track user activity to prevent unauthorized access, all with zero business interruption.

For example, a retail chain sees discrepancies in Data, mismatches between sales and inventory data. We set up monitoring systems to help you identify gaps & issues, flag them, and even automatically trigger some fixes with the help of AI Agents.

When you rely on your data warehouse for business-critical decisions, even the smallest error can lead to misguided strategies and poor decisions. Without thorough testing, issues like broken pipelines, outdated data, and mismatched values go unnoticed, leaving your teams with unreliable, poor quality insights.

We implement robust testing frameworks to ensure every Data query returns accurate results. We manage workflows and automate testing with Apache Airflow, and use dbt for data quality checks to ensure consistency. Great Expectations helps us maintain data integrity, catching discrepancies early. We also use Testcontainers to verify schema changes and business logic, ensuring the system remains stable.

For example, a financial services company continuously tests its data warehouse before updates hit the dashboard. When a new data source is integrated, automated tests check for discrepancies, ensuring the numbers always align. If an issue arises, the system flags it instantly, so the fix is applied before it affects reporting.

As your data grows with new data sources, performance can lag. Queries can take longer, leading to decisions getting delayed. Without continuous optimization, your data warehouse can become a bottleneck for your business.

We audit your data warehouse with SQL Profiler and Query Store to identify bottlenecks like slow queries and resource issues. For optimization, we apply indexing, partitioning, and query adjustments, using Apache Spark for large-scale data processing. We improve data quality with Talend for cleansing and validation, and implement Collibra to ensure compliance and data accuracy.

Example: A retail company faces delays in processing sales reports due to slow query performance. After auditing the system, performance issues like inefficient queries and poor data structure are identified. Indexing and query adjustments are applied, improving reporting speed and enabling quicker decision-making.

Industry- Specific Data Warehouse Solutions

 
Industry Key Data Types How We Help
Healthcare
  • EHR data (patient history, diagnoses, treatments)
  • Medical imaging (X-rays, MRIs, CT scans)
  • Claims data, lab results, and asset utilization
We centralize patient and clinical data for real-time decision-making, improving patient care and ensuring regulatory compliance.
Insurance
  • Claims data, customer demographics
  • Agent activity
  • Financial data (premiums, claims, payroll)
Our solutions integrate diverse data sources such as claims data, customer demographics, agent activity, to improve claims processing, fraud detection, and customer insights.
Retail & Ecommerce
  • Inventory management
  • Customer behavior and demographics
  • Order fulfillment and transaction data
We create a unified data view that boosts stock management, improves customer experience, and optimizes marketing strategies.
Transportation & Logistics
  • Telematics data (vehicle location, fuel usage)
  • Driver behavior
  • Weather, traffic, and inventory data
We enable real-time tracking and performance analytics, optimizing route planning, inventory management, and cost efficiency.
   

Stop losing time and money to a broken data warehouse.

Data Warehouse, Done Right.

Data can be your biggest MOAT—when managed right. Codewave helps turn complex data into your business’s most valuable asset.

Diagnosis & Assessment

Every business has a unique vision and strategy, and yours deserves to be understood. The first step is assessing your current data setup to identify gaps, inefficiencies, and bottlenecks stopping your business growth. We analyze the challenges you face, such as insufficent data, slow reporting, data inaccuracies, or disconnected systems. Through this stage, we identify areas of improvement which will have a measurable ROI.

Data Strategy

Next, we work with you to define a clear data strategy & AI strategy that aligns with your vision and goals. This involves a Design-thinking workshop with business stakeholders to understand how you create value for your customers, how you run your operations and what challenges your teams are facing with respect to people, process or technology. Based on these sessions, we define how Data could be your biggest MOAT and what solutions could help (be it better data pipelines, storage frameworks, and access protocols) that will get your business unstuck and thrive.

Startegic Execution

Once the Data strategy is clear, we implement the systems and processes necessary to support your business needs. During this phase, we ensure that your data moves seamlessly across platforms with minimal downtime, and we carefully integrate new systems into your existing infrastructure. Additionally, we automate processes with AI Agents for faster operations while ensuring accuracy and security.

Testing & Optimization

Post implementation, we rigorously test the system to ensure it is performing at its best. We conduct load tests to simulate high-volume data and optimize query performance. We also focus on data accuracy and the fine-tuning of data flows to ensure that reports and insights are consistently reliable. By optimizing the system for performance and efficiency, we help ensure that your data warehouse can scale with your business.

Training & Handover

By this stage, your team will be ready to tap into the full potential of your data warehouse. We provide hands-on training to visualize data, generate reports ensuring your team can use the system effectively. Clear, step-by-step documentation helps your team manage the system with confidence. By the end of the training, your team will have everything needed to run the system smoothly and tackle issues independently.

Ongoing Support

Your data warehouse is in safe hands. We continuosly monitor performance and alert you to any issues, while automating updates to ensure continuous smooth operations. Proactive monitoring and regular updates address potential issues before they disrupt your work, ensuring your data warehouse evolves with your business needs.

The Tech Stack Powering Your Data Warehouse

Data Storage

Snowflake, Amazon Redshift, Azure Synapse

Data Integration

Apache Kafka, Fivetran, Talend

Data Quality

Talend, Informatica, Ataccama

Data Governance

Collibra, Alation

Data Processing

Apache Spark, Databricks

ETL/ELT

Apache NiFi, AWS Glue

Data Visualization & BI

Power BI, Tableau, Looker

Security & Compliance

IBM Guardium, AWS IAM, Azure Security Center

What to expect

What to expect working with us.

We transform companies!

Codewave is an award-winning company that transforms businesses by generating ideas, building products, and accelerating growth.

Frequently asked questions

Our design thinking methodology ensures your data warehouse solution is built with user needs at the center. We start by deeply understanding your business processes, user workflows, and analytics requirements before architecting the technical solution. This approach leads to higher user adoption, better ROI, and more meaningful insights from your data.

 Implementation timelines vary based on complexity and scope, but typically range from 3-6 months for initial deployment. Our agile methodology allows for quick wins with iterative improvements. We provide a detailed timeline during the discovery phase, with clear milestones and deliverables.

We implement multiple layers of security including encryption at rest and in transit, role-based access control, and audit logging. Our solutions comply with industry standards (GDPR, HIPAA, etc.) and we conduct regular security assessments. We also provide documentation and training for security best practices.

Yes, we specialize in integrating diverse data sources including legacy systems, cloud applications, and third-party services. Our expertise spans multiple integration patterns (ETL/ELT, real-time, batch) and we ensure seamless connectivity while maintaining data quality and consistency.

We offer flexible support packages including 24/7 monitoring, performance optimization, user training, and regular health checks. Our global team ensures continuous support across time zones, with defined SLAs and dedicated support channels.

We implement comprehensive data governance frameworks including data quality rules, metadata management, and data lineage tracking. Our solutions include automated quality checks, cleansing procedures, and monitoring tools to ensure data accuracy and reliability.

Our unique combination of design thinking methodology, global expertise, and focus on SME needs sets us apart. We provide end-to-end solutions from strategy to implementation, with a proven track record of successful deployments across multiple industries and geographies.

Costs vary based on project scope, complexity, and ongoing support needs. We offer flexible pricing models including fixed-price projects and monthly subscriptions. We work with you to define a solution that fits your budget while delivering maximum value.